Summary

"Chambers's Journal of Popular Literature, Science, and Art, Fifth Series, No.…" by Various is a window into the late 19th century through a diverse collection of essays exploring literature, science, art, and aspects of daily life. This periodical features articles that examine the romanticized views of smugglers versus the harsh truths of their lives, with an anonymous officer revealing clever evasion tactics from both historical and current times. The collection broadens its scope, offering contemplations on subjects ranging from the ivory trade and anthropoid apes, to personal reflections on fortune and the pursuit of happiness, capturing a wide spectrum of human experiences of that era.
